Paperback. Condition: new. Paperback. (String). This extraordinary work by Sofia Gubaidulina features the unusual combination of two solo violas and orchestra. It was commissioned by Kurt Masur, who conducted its sensational premiere in 1999 with the New York Philharmonic. The subtitle, "A Dedication to Mary and Martha," refers to two New Testament figures whose contrasting experiences of worldly and spiritual love provide the dramatic stimulus for the music. Condition: Gut. 36 S.; 24,5 cm; geheftet. Gutes Ex.; Einband gering berieben. - BeilageDeutsch u. englisch. - Sofia Asgatowna Gubaidulina (wiss. Transliteration Sofija Asgatovna Gubajdulina, * 24. Oktober 1931 in Tschistopol, Tatarische Autonome Sowjetrepublik) ist eine russische Komponistin. In der Mitte der 1970er Jahre gründete Gubaidulina gemeinsam mit den Komponisten Viktor Suslin und Wjatscheslaw Artjomow das Ensemble Astreja, das auf Instrumenten der russischen Volksmusik improvisierte. In den sechziger und siebziger Jahren waren ihre Werke in der Sowjetunion verboten, weil ihre Musik nicht den Vorstellungen des Sozialistischen Realismus entsprach. Ihr Erfolg im Westen wurde vor allem vom Stargeiger Gidon Kremer (später auch von Reinbert de Leeuw) unterstützt, der ihr erstes Violinkonzert Offertorium 1981 uraufführte. Seitdem gehört Sofia Gubaidulina zusammen mit Alfred Schnittke und Edisson Denissow zu den führenden, weltweit anerkannten Komponisten Russlands der Ära nach Schostakowitsch.
